Bracket Replacement - Knee Bolster (Passenger)

BRACKET REPLACEMENT - KNEE BOLSTER (PASSENGER)

REMOVAL PROCEDURE




1. Remove the console.
2. Remove the IP accessory trim plate.
3. Remove the driver knee bolster trim panel.
4. Remove the IP passenger compartment.
5. Remove the IP upper trim pad.
6. Mark the location of the passenger knee bolster bracket. Refer to Instrument Panel (I/P) Disassembly Precautions.

IMPORTANT: The following step must be performed to assure proper trim fits during installation.

7. Remove the bolts retaining the passenger knee bolster bracket to the IP center support bracket.




8. Remove the bolts retaining the passenger knee bolster bracket to the passenger SIR bracket.
9. Remove the passenger knee bolster bracket.

INSTALLATION PROCEDURE




1. Install the passenger knee bolster bracket as marked prior to removal.
2. Install the passenger knee bolster bracket to passenger SIR bracket retaining bolts.

NOTE: Refer to Fastener Notice in Service Precautions.

Tighten
Tighten the passenger knee bolster bracket retaining bolts to 12 N.m (106 lb in).




3. Install the passenger knee bolster bracket to IP center support bracket retaining bolts.

Tighten
Tighten the passenger knee bolster bracket retaining bolts to 12 N.m (106 lb in).

4. Install the IP upper trim pad.
5. Install the IP passenger compartment.
6. Install the driver knee bolster trim panel.
7. Install the IP accessory trim plate.
8. Install the console.
